Niran Boy
Name Meaning & Origin Pronunciation: NEE-ron /nɪˈrɑːn/
Origin: Sanskrit; Thai
Meaning: Sanskrit: 'eternal'; Thai: 'to be free'

U.S. Historical Usage
The name Niran was first seen in the United States in 2006.
Niran has ranked as high as #1393 nationally, which occurred in 2008, and has been most popular in .
In the past 5 years the name Niran has been trending down compared to the previous 5 years.

Popularity Over Time (National) — Table
We track the national popularity of each baby name annually. The table below displays each year along with the number of births reported by the Social Security Administration. This data combines all state-level reporting from the SSA's baby names database to provide a comprehensive view of overall birth counts for Niran.
| Year | Births |
|---|---|
| 2024 | 5 |
| 2023 | 5 |
| 2018 | 6 |
| 2017 | 5 |
| 2008 | 7 |
| 2006 | 6 |
